Transaction 685337ae3f63d72da2e95fff41a96e721d811eff82a0a9e984c4e6efe1e23d28

1 Input
2 Outputs
  • 685337ae3f63d72da2e95fff41a96e721d811eff82a0a9e984c4e6efe1e23d28:0
  • value  1327900
    address  3G8NuhNW5Dcvi3S7UBpQ15FXumFfVG4tkT
  • 685337ae3f63d72da2e95fff41a96e721d811eff82a0a9e984c4e6efe1e23d28:1
  • value  12775793
    address  1Z8ghXoMhRzdzvMvhgUtVMqiZTszaYYvP